unflinching
adjective un·flinch·ing \-ˈflin-chiŋ\
: staying strong and determined even when things are difficult
: looking at or describing something or someone in a very direct way
Full Definition of UNFLINCHING
: not flinching or shrinking : steadfast, uncompromising <unflinching determination>
— un·flinch·ing·ly \-chiŋ-lē\ adverb

First Known Use of UNFLINCHING
1728
Related to UNFLINCHING
- Synonyms
- determined, dogged, grim, implacable, relentless, unappeasable, unyielding, unrelenting
